Asbestos, once a staple in construction, manufacturing, and other industries due to its heat resistance and durability, has left a legacy of severe health consequences. When asbestos fibers are inhaled or ingested, they can lodge in the body’s tissues, leading to a range of debilitating diseases, including asbestosis, lung cancer, and the particularly aggressive cancer, mesothelioma. These diseases often take decades to develop, meaning individuals exposed to asbestos in the past may only recently have received a diagnosis. Introduction to Asbestos Trust Funds

In response to the overwhelming number of asbestos-related lawsuits, many companies that produced or used asbestos sought bankruptcy protection. To ensure that victims could still receive compensation, these companies were required to establish asbestos trust funds. These funds are designed to compensate individuals who have developed asbestos-related diseases, providing financial relief for medical expenses, lost income, and suffering.

What Are Asbestos Trust Funds?

The Origins of Asbestos Trust Funds

Asbestos trust funds were established as part of the bankruptcy reorganization plans of companies overwhelmed by asbestos-related lawsuits. Under Section 524(g) of the U.S. Bankruptcy Code, these companies set aside funds to compensate current and future victims of asbestos exposure. The establishment of these funds was crucial in ensuring that even after a company’s dissolution, its victims could still receive the compensation they are entitled to.

How Asbestos Trust Funds Work

Each asbestos trust fund operates independently, with its own set of rules and criteria for evaluating claims. Trustees manage these funds, overseeing the process of evaluating claims, determining eligibility, and disbursing payments. Claims are typically assessed based on medical documentation, proof of asbestos exposure, and the connection between the exposure and the company responsible.

The Types of Claims Covered

Asbestos trust funds cover a variety of asbestos-related diseases, including:

  • Mesothelioma Trust Fund Claims: Mesothelioma is directly linked to asbestos exposure and is often given priority in trust fund payouts due to the severity of the disease.
  • Lung Cancer Trust Fund Claims: While lung cancer has multiple causes, asbestos exposure is a significant contributor, making these claims eligible for compensation from asbestos trust funds.
  • Asbestosis Trust Fund Claims: Asbestosis, a chronic lung disease caused by inhaling asbestos fibers, can also be covered, although these claims may result in lower payouts compared to mesothelioma cases.
  • Other Asbestos-Related Diseases: Additional conditions, such as pleural plaques or diffuse pleural thickening, may also be eligible for compensation, depending on the trust fund’s criteria.

How Much Money is Left in the Asbestos Trust Funds?

The current landscape of asbestos trust funds reveals a diverse picture. Some funds are well-capitalized, while others are depleting. Collectively, asbestos trust funds hold approximately $30 billion, but the amount available in each individual fund can vary significantly. The solvency of these funds impacts future claims, with payout percentages being adjusted based on the fund's financial health.

Who Is Eligible for Asbestos Trust Fund Payouts?

Eligibility Criteria for Filing a Claim

To file a claim with an asbestos trust fund, victims must meet several key eligibility criteria:

  1. Proof of Asbestos Exposure: Claimants must provide evidence of their exposure to asbestos, such as employment records, military service documentation, or witness statements.
  2. Medical Diagnosis: A confirmed diagnosis of an asbestos-related disease, such as mesothelioma, lung cancer, or asbestosis, is required to support the claim.
  3. Causation: There must be a clear link between asbestos exposure and the disease. This often involves demonstrating that the exposure occurred during the period when the responsible company was operational.
  4. Timely Filing: Each trust fund has specific deadlines for filing claims. Failing to meet these deadlines can result in a denial of compensation.

Special Considerations for Mesothelioma Claims

Mesothelioma claims are typically given priority by asbestos trust funds due to the severity and clear link between asbestos exposure and the disease. Individuals diagnosed with mesothelioma may be eligible to file claims with multiple trust funds, especially if they were exposed to asbestos in various workplaces. This can significantly increase the total compensation received.

Eligibility for Lung Cancer, Asbestosis, and Other Conditions

Victims of asbestos-related lung cancer and asbestosis are also eligible for compensation, though these cases may require more extensive documentation to establish the link to asbestos exposure. Other conditions, such as pleural plaques or gastrointestinal cancers related to asbestos exposure, may also qualify for compensation from specific trust funds.

Filing Claims with Multiple Trust Funds

Many victims were exposed to asbestos through different employers or products, making them eligible to file claims with multiple asbestos trust funds. Filing with multiple funds can maximize the total compensation, but it requires a detailed understanding of each fund's criteria and careful documentation of exposure across different times and locations. How Are Asbestos Trust Fund Payouts Calculated?

Factors That Influence Payout Amounts

Several factors influence the amount of compensation a victim can receive from an asbestos trust fund:

  1. Disease Severity: The more severe the disease, the higher the potential payout. Mesothelioma, for instance, usually results in higher compensation due to its aggressive nature and strong association with asbestos exposure.
  2. Exposure History: The duration, intensity, and circumstances of asbestos exposure significantly impact the payout. Detailed and well-documented exposure histories generally lead to higher compensation.
  3. Trust Fund Solvency: The financial health of the trust fund plays a crucial role in determining payout amounts. Trust funds periodically adjust their payout percentages based on their current assets, meaning the amount a victim receives can vary depending on the fund’s solvency.
  4. Payout Percentages: Asbestos trust funds typically do not pay 100% of the claim’s value. Instead, they apply a payout percentage, which is a fraction of the total claim value. These percentages vary widely among different funds and can fluctuate over time.

Valuation and Payment of Claims

Once a claim is filed, the asbestos trust fund assigns a value based on a predetermined schedule that considers the severity of the disease and the exposure level. The value assigned to the claim is then adjusted by the current payout percentage of the trust fund.

For example, if a claim is valued at $200,000 and the trust's payout percentage is 25%, the victim would receive $50,000. These percentages can change, so the timing of filing a claim can affect the payout amount. The Process of Filing an Asbestos Trust Fund Claim

Step-by-Step Guide to Filing a Claim

Filing a claim with an asbestos trust fund involves several steps, which your asbestos lawyer will handle for you:

  1. Collect Necessary Documentation: Gather medical records, employment history, and any other evidence of asbestos exposure. This documentation is critical in establishing eligibility and supporting the claim, and your asbestos lawyer will gather everything you need or guide you through this process to make it as fast as possible.
  2. Identify Relevant Trust Funds: Determine which asbestos trust funds are relevant based on your exposure history. This may involve identifying multiple funds if exposure occurred through different companies or products.
  3. Complete and Submit the Claim Form: Each trust fund has its own claim form. Fill it out carefully, ensuring all required information is provided. Incomplete or inaccurate forms can delay the processing of the claim.
  4. Review Process: Once submitted, the trust fund will review the claim. This process can involve a detailed examination of the submitted documentation to ensure the claim meets the eligibility criteria.
  5. Approval and Payment: If the claim is approved, the trust fund will calculate the payout based on the current payout percentage and disburse the funds to the claimant. The time frame for receiving payment can vary depending on the trust fund’s procedures and the complexity of the claim.
